Unify point tangent, angle\length\direction
Short rationales:
Point Angle - I need a way to control the exact angle of point handles to unify them across a design. Currently the only way to control the angle is to constrain it to vertical, horizontal, or 45 degree angles.Point Handle Length\Direction - If you grab a point handle and make it a different length or direction than the handle on the other side of a point, there is currently no way to re-unify them besides re-drawing the curve.
There is also no also no way to scale handle length along the direction or angle you’ve already set.More information:
Point Angle - There is currently no way to control the exact rotation of a point, so if for example, I need one point at 29 degrees and another at 82 degrees, there’s no way to specify this. Also, if I have a series of points across a design and I want all of the tangent angles to match, there’s no way to do it. This is especially troublesome when drawing type. Very often you want points at 0 degrees, 90 degrees and then an italic angle across all of the letters. The closest you can currently come to specifying that is creating a series of guidelines, but that can become very cumbersome and they don’t often aline with the exact point coordinates.Point Handle Length\Direction - Every single design that I use the pen tool on, I come across a situation where I either uncouple point handle directions, or lengths. If I want to get the perfect angle and direction set on one side and then want to match it on the other, I can’t. I have to use the Anchor Point Tool to redraw the curve, which causes the line to reset. This is also an issue when drawing things like type. If you use, for example, the Direct Selection Tool, and drag a handle out to create a shape, there’s no way to then drag the other handle out on the same line, or to unify it’s corresponding handle’s length.

A new tool that copies exactly the color that's seen by the user on the screen through transparent objects
Currently, when I like a certain color that's formed through the combination of 2 or more transparent objects (or objects with blend modes applied), I can't copy that exact color. The eye-dropper tool simply copies the color from the topmost object. I often find myself taking a snap of the display and then paste that image within illustrator and copying the color I want from that image.
Request: I'd like a tool, similar to the eye-dropper, but instead, it picks the RESULTANT color(s) that is displayed through transparent objects or even objects with BLEND-MODES applied to them.

Smart Guides and the Rotate Tool: Incremental Rotation Angles
When rotating an object with the rotate tool and holding shift, objects snap to 45° increments.
I am suggesting that increments of rotation be customizable, allowing such increments as 1°, 5°, 10° 15° 30° and 45°.
Trying to get integer values of rotation, with the current method of dragging to rotate an object, is nigh impossible. This would allow for easier creation of polar arrays and the accurate rotation of objects in general.
